Why this route

What makes Great Ocean Road worth planning well

A Great Ocean Road day is about more than reaching the 12 Apostles. It is a long coastal route with rainforest, cliff views and small towns, so the best plan balances the places you care about with enough time to enjoy them.

Give the route enough room

Choosing fewer meaningful stops usually feels better than trying to fit in every landmark.

Choose your coast-and-rainforest mix

Lorne, Apollo Bay, lookouts and rainforest walks each create a different kind of day.

Keep the return realistic

Daylight, weather, meal breaks and your Melbourne plans should shape the final route.

Private planning

Plan the coast around your available time

Start with your Melbourne pickup point, the season and whether the 12 Apostles are the priority. A private plan can favour a scenic coastal drive, rainforest and seaside stops, or a more direct route with selected highlights. Travelling with children, returning on a flight day, or staying overnight all change the right pace.
